Body found in Christchurch's Port Hills believed to be missing woman
Police have found a body, believed to be that of an elderly woman who has been missing since July, in Christchurch’s Port Hills.
A police spokesperson said the body was found on Monday morning.
“We believe we know the identity of the person, but the formal identification process is ongoing.”
Stuff understands the body is believed to be Shirley Warrington. The 85-year-old grandmother went missing in July.
